How to get rid of fleas from your home?

Fleas are a problem to get rid of when they have actually taken over your house. They breed so promptly that if you find just one flea in your house it's too late.

Fleas are parasites, which means that they need a host to live off. So if you have a pet cat or pet dog, they will jump onto them and also survive off their temperature, hair and blood.

They can additionally make it through in your carpets, simply coming near you to suck on your blood for the day before returning, so you're not risk-free even if you do not have family pets

If you discover you have fleas, there are some things you need to do as soon as you can to get rid of them.

  • Treat your pets.
  • Briefly remove your animal from your house
  • Laundry all your clothes and also sheets
  • Obtain a fogger
  • Hire the pros

how to tell if woodworm is active?

It can be rather hard to identify whether woodworm are energetic or whether the damages and also holes are historical, particularly if you buy a product of antique furniture with indicators of woodworm, or if you move right into a new location as well as find some indicators of woodworm. Apart from searching for as well as determining live or dead bugs the major methods of informing if woodworm are energetic are:

 

  • Fresh cleaning or frassing under or beside the holes
  • You can see light coloured timber in the holes, which have sharp edges
  • Edges of wooden light beams as well as joists are breaking away to reveal fresh, light timber beneath

The hardest part of the procedure is to appropriately diagnose if activity is present or historic so to start with there are some simple indications:

  • Brand-new exit openings in timbers, the shapes and size will certainly additionally identify the type of timber uninteresting beetle. The most typical, which is usually refered to as 'woodworm', is the usual furniture beetle (Anobium punctatum) as well as this leaves a rounded hole 1-2mm in size. It does depend on the type of timber however a brand-new opening is often 'intense' with a typical new wood colour where as an older opening might become dark as well as much less smooth.
  • Dirt, noticeable bore dirt called 'Frass' listed below the holes is usually the simplest sign of activity as aged dirt will blow away over time. Again the shape of the dirt can additionally aid identify the kind of beetle, Deathe watch beetle dirt has little 'bun' designed pellets noticeable to the naked eye.
  • Actual Beetles, on occasion you will certainly locate dead beeltes specifically on window sills as many emerge from springtime to the end of summer though its the Larva that cause one of the most harm with some kinds living and feeding for several years within the wood.
  • Crumbling hardwoods, this will certainly most commonly take place on floorboards as they have a tendency to be thinner than roof lumbers or joists and also will escape to the touch.

These are the most convenient signs of activity though there are expert examinations that can be finished most are not cost effective, the dampness material of the lumbers can additionally be an indicator as to whether infestation might take place as fairly completely dry timber will certainly not be susceptible (this would need a deep probe examination).

how to get rid of rats in garden?

Being smart critters, a rodent infestation of a garden can cause the owner a lot of problems. Rats are pests bringing about a wide range of health hazards. They’ll camp in your compost, eat away your fruits and vegetables, gnaw through fences, containers and planters and even spread harmful diseases to humans. The wild rats can bite or even scratch when approached and will seek shelter anywhere possible like in your greenhouses, shed and even in your home. And worse still, they reproduce quickly as a female rat can give birth to six litters annually with up to 12 pups. Therefore, if left unattended to,an unwelcome visit can soon become an infestation in next to no time.

 

In order to get rid of rats, you can start by thinking like one. Like any other mammal, they need food, water and shelter to survive and thrive. Removing one or all these three things can effectively help you get rid of rats in your garden. Generally, there are several ways to get rid of rats which can be natural without the use of poison and artificial, with the use of poison.

 

If you wish to use the natural approach, you can try using peppermint oil or laying of traps. Rats are known to hate peppermint and it’s also alleged to mask their pheromone trails. Simply soak cotton wool balls in peppermint oil and position them strategically through out the garden. The second natural approach is more of a trial and error case as rats are always very suspicious and it’s possible your traps fail to catch any unless you’re very cunning with the placement.

 

The most effective method is, however, the use of poison to get rid of rats. Simply mix the poison with food in small quantities and place at strategic locations throughout your garden to get rid of the rats, However, this must be done with great care.

how to get rid of bed bugs?

Nobody likes bed bug! The sight of one can send even the most rational people you know into a state a state of panic. However, it doesn’t have to be so as there are a bunch of effective ways you can employ to get rid of bed bug infestation in a way that’ll fit both your budget as well as schedule. Although, it’ll take both diligence and consistency from your part, but it’ll take care of the bed bug infestation for good. In this post, we’re going to walk you through an effective process in which you can get rid of bed bug infestation in your home. Let’s take a look!

 

  • Prepare your room for the treatment. This involves removing any items in the room that you can’t treat or that have already been treated. Cover the items that will be removed with plastic bags before moving them to the next room in order to prevent any unseen bed bug from infesting the other room. Also, remove the painting or art from the walls and check all the items that’s removed thoroughly to make sure the bed bugs are not transferred to the other room. If your mattress is heavily infested, you’d have to cover it with a bed bug proof mattress cover or a bed bug mattress encasement before moving
  • Treat the crevices, cracks, tufts and folds of your home for bed bugs. Make use of a variety of products to kill and control beg bugs for a more effective result.
  • Treat your mattress for beg bugs. To do this, make use of an aerosol spray labelled for bed bug treatment and spray the insecticide onto the mattress while focusing on the seams, tufts and folds until the mattress appears damp. Then allow it to dry before remaking the bed. Once done, you can also encase the mattress in a bed bug proof cover to prevent re-infestation.
